What Ukrainian applicants need
- Ukraine passport valid 6+ months
- Recent digital photo (auto-captured)
- Travel dates (entry & exit)
- Accommodation in Oman
- Last bank statement
- Return ticket (optional)

FAQ for Ukrainian applicants
Do Ukrainian citizens need a visa for Oman?+
Yes. Ukrainian passport holders need a E-Visa to enter Oman. It can be applied for entirely online through Vizaezy and is typically issued in 48 hours.
How long does the Oman visa take for Ukrainian applicants?+

How long can Ukrainian citizens stay in Oman?+
The E-Visa permits a stay of up to 30 days and is valid for 30 days from issue.
